I have a PB Titanium 500 which I got from my boss. When I put in a CD and try to run anything, the PB is very noisy and vibrates. On occation, it refused to mount a CD or DVD. It being the Titanium it's not so easily removable.

Any ideas?

A few things,

Check that it still has all it's feet.
Certain CDs with "heavy" labels will cause the drive to spin inconsistenly.
CDs that were burned at high speeds will spin at high speeds. (I think)

I've had it happen only once to mine, I tried to install W2K Pro from CD using bochs. I let it run during the night and my TiBook vibrated off the table. Otherwise my CD Drive is pretty quiet but I've only used old software and DVDs with it.
